Sideshow reveals new photography of their latest GI Joe statue: Snake Eyes and Timber. Pre-orders for this fan favorite character and his pet wolf begin Thursday, June 23rd.
https://www.figures.com/forums/attachment.php?attachmentid=19853&stc=1&d=1308748705https://www.figures.com/forums/attachment.php?attachmentid=19852&stc=1&d=1308748705
The Exclusive Snake Eyes and Timber Statue, which will include a switch-out right hand holding a Falchion Sword will be priced at $324.99 and will have an Edition Size of 500 pieces. Additionally, the regular version, without the switch-out accessory will be available for pre-order priced at $324.99. Both editions of this statue will be sold on a first come, first served basis, and will have the FLEXPay option available as a payment choice.
